The Federalist: American Support For An Assault Weapons Ban Just Hit A Record Low

A new survey from Gallup recorded the lowest support for an assault weapons ban in its history. The most interesting data point from the poll is that the 36% support for a ban is a bipartisan position. Bearing Arms: LA Times Editorial Attacks Gun Rights, Calls For Nationwide Microstamping

The Los Angeles Times published an editorial Monday attacking firearms, this time by advocating for the use of microstamping to solve crimes. The Times noted that once California passed microstamping requirements, gun manufacturers simply stopped selling new models in the state.
